In November 2025, Uzbekistan’s gold and foreign exchange reserves increased by almost $1.9 billion, according to a Central Bank report.
According to information, they amounted to $59.3 billion by this date, and 61.2 billion soums at the beginning of December. It is noted that this became a record figure for the entire period of statistics.
In addition, the regulator reported that the physical volume of gold amounted to 12.2 million troy ounces, the value — 50.8 billion dollars. At the same time, foreign exchange reserves amounted to $8.2 billion.
